Localised (pitting) corrosion of copper is typically classified into three categories Type I (Cold-water pitting), Type II (Hot-water pitting) and Type III (Soft Water pitting). Copper corrosion occurs at negligible rates in unpolluted air, water and deaerated non-oxidizing acids. In particular, the Copper & Copper Alloy Corrosion Resistance Database is derived from work done in 1994 by David B. Anderson, a corrosion expert with extensive experience on computer databases of corrosion data, who reviewed existing corrosion tables for copper alloys and expanded and improved upon them.
